Output 223f77ef30f2621c51fac2bd3b21109a01f2bfe59ed68a68cf9d9fff4a2aa251:65

value
1066126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46d93938bac578a286bbdebe486ade9ae18f195a OP_EQUALVERIFY OP_CHECKSIG
address
17TcXPDW4pgCwsi5iN1L8MWu8CxUM5RZ6z
transaction
223f77ef30f2621c51fac2bd3b21109a01f2bfe59ed68a68cf9d9fff4a2aa251
spent
true